Trafficking in women is 'an octopus with many tentacles,' said Sister Yvonne Clemence Bambara, who runs a rehabilitation centre in Burkina Faso.

Girls freed from the clutches of human traffickers worldwide are given shelter by nuns from the Talitha Kum network, which is marking its 10th anniversary with support from Pope Francis.

The Argentine choose an anti-trafficking Italian nun to write the Way of Cross meditations this Easter, with seasoned campaigner Eugenia Bonetti slamming public"indifference" as the main reason girls are still on the street.
